Marcus & Millichap, Inc., an investment brokerage company, provides commercial real estate investment sales, financing services, research and advisory services in the United States and Canada. The company offers research on various property types comprising multifamily, retail, office, industrial, single-tenant net lease, seniors housing, self-storage, hospitality, medical office, and manufactured housing, as well as capital markets/financing. It also operates as a financial intermediary that provides commercial real estate capital markets solutions, including senior debt, mezzanine debt, joint venture, preferred equity, and securitization services, as well as loan sales and due diligence services to commercial real estate owners, developers, and investors. In addition, the company offers a way to buy and sell commercial property as a complement to its traditional property marketing channels. Further, it provides advisory and consulting services, which include opinions of value, operating and financial performance benchmarking analysis, specific asset buy-sell strategies, market and submarket analysis and ranking, portfolio strategies by property type, market strategy, development and redevelopment feasibility studies, and other services; and leasing services for tenants and/or landlords in connection with commercial real estate leases. Marcus & Millichap, Inc. was founded in 1971 and is headquartered in Calabasas, California.
